HOUSE RESOLUTION

 
2    W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ois House of
3Representatives are saddened to learn of the death of Nancy
4Marie Nozicka, who passed away on July 10, 2022; and
 
5    WHEREAS, Nancy Nozicka was born in Berwyn in 1958; she was
6raised in the nearby town of Cicero, where she lived until her
7early 20s; she graduated from Morton East High School, where
8she played badminton and volleyball; she later earned her
9undergraduate degree in Nursing from Loyola University
10Chicago; she married Charles "Chuck" Nozicka, and they enjoyed
11a 40-year marriage and raised four children; and
 
12    WHEREAS, Nancy Nozicka had a 38-year career in nursing at
13Northwestern Lake Forest Hospital, where she was a walking
14embodiment of patient-centered care; after decades of
15experience in the Emergency Department, she pursued her Master
16of Science to become an Advanced Practice Registered Nurse
17(APRN); she worked as a clinical nurse specialist in the
18Emergency Department, and she later pioneered the role as her
19hospital's first heart failure coordinator, a position she
20viewed as honoring the lived experiences of her beloved
21father; and
